unc-17 | UNCoordinated 17 | unc-17 encodes acteylcholine transporter which is expressed in motor [18041778] and inter-neurons and is downregulated in space. Mutation of unc-17 extends lifespan on NGM agar covered with killed or live bacteria. nc-17(CB933) extends mean, 75%ile, and maximum lifespan by 31-79%, 68-89%, and 68-79%. Lifespan extension by unc-17 mutation is totally abolished by RNAi inactivation of daf-16, but not skn-1. eat-2 RNAi further enhances the extension of lifespan by mutations of unc-17 [22768380].
Mutation and RNAi of unc-17 suppresses pheromone-induced dauer formation [22768380].

unc-64 | UNCoordinated | Mutations in unc-64 result in constitutive dauer formation and increase lifespan, which is suppressed by mutations in daf-16 [10377425]. unc-64 mutation increases mean and maximum lifespan [16280150]. unc-64 mutation increased lifespan of hermaphrodites by approximately 70% and those of males by 150% [10377425; 4366476; 10747056].
unc-64 mutants are uncoordinated [4366476]. | Nematode |

tdp-1 | TAR DNA-binding Protein homolog 1 | tdp-1(ok803) mutation increases mean and maximum lifespan at 20 degree Celsius but not at 25 degree Celsius. tdp-1(ok803) reduce the lifespan of daf-2(e1370) mutants, but does not does not reduces the lifespan of daf-16(mu86) mutants. RNAi against tdp-1 reduces lifepsna of daf-2(e1370) mutants. tdp-1 overexpression strains have a reduced lifespan at 20 and 25 degree Celsius [Vaccaro et al. 2012]. | Nematode |
